Ingredients

  • 5 cups water
  • 3–4 blackberry tea bags or 2 black tea bags + ½ cup fresh blackberries
  • 5–6 fresh sage leaves (plus more for garnish)
  • 1–2 tablespoons honey or maple syrup, to taste
  • ½ tablespoon lemon juice (optional for brightness)
  • Ice and fresh blackberries, for serving

Instructions

Step 1: Boil and Steep

Bring water to a boil. Remove from heat and steep blackberry tea bags (or black tea + fresh blackberries) along with sage leaves for 10 minutes.

Step 2: Strain and Sweeten

Strain the tea into a pitcher. Stir in honey or maple syrup while still warm, and add lemon juice if using.

Step 3: Chill

Let the tea cool to room temperature, then refrigerate for at least 1 hour.

Step 4: Serve

Pour over ice and garnish with blackberries and sage sprigs. Serve in clear glasses to show off the vibrant color!

Variations

  • 🍹 Sparkling version – add club soda or sparkling water before serving
  • 🍋 Citrus twist – add orange or lemon slices
  • 🍓 Berry blend – mix in raspberries or blueberries
  • 🍸 Cocktail – add a splash of gin or vodka for an herbal summer cocktail

Tips for Success

  • 🌿 Crush the sage slightly to release more flavor
  • ❄️ Use blackberry ice cubes for extra flavor and color
  • 🍵 Use herbal tea if you want a completely caffeine-free drink
  • 🫙 Make a double batch—it stores well in the fridge for up to 3 days
